Mission of the Position
The Advanced Engineering eMotor Engineer will work in the advanced engineering e-motor group within pre-development. They evaluate new and innovative fields of technology and applies them to new applications in coordination with the Future Products and Serial Production Groups. The engineer will work closely with the global advanced engineering team, while staying connected and close to the North American product engineering organization.
We are seeking intermediate to senior level candidates – level determined based on candidate experience and expertise in the required areas outlined below.
As an Intermediate level engineer, the engineer will work independently with limited supervision to evaluate, select, and apply standard engineering techniques, procedures, and criteria using knowledge and judgement to make adaptations and modifications.
As a Senior Engineer, the engineer will independently perform a wide variety of complex/advanced engineering work to include planning, designing, and carrying out work assignments, often serving as a technical authority of the department with little to no supervision. The engineer will mentor and guide less experienced team members.
Key Responsibilities
- Evaluation of the state of the art and new innovative technologies (including benchmarking) in the field of electric motor design with a focus on traction drives.
- Close contact to other departments of the company as well as to cooperation partners in the field of industry and research.
- Design, calculation, and simulation of electric motors for traction drives in motor vehicles.
- Development or further development of the calculation and simulation tools (benchmarking, calibrations).
- Identification, evaluation, and implementation of technical innovations.
- Development of scalable tools and methods for designing the defined technologies.

Requirements and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ering, physics, or mechatronics required, Master’s degree preferred.
- 5 – 7 years of experience in eMotor design engineering (intermediate) required.
- 7-10 year of experience in eMotor design engineering (senior) required.
- Experience/knowledge in designing and simulating electrical machines.
- Know-how in the field of electrical drive technology.
- Methodical way of working and focus on model-based development.
- Experience in the field of technologies for e-machine production.
- Experience in handling FE tools for electromagnetic design, preferably ANSYS RMxprt, ANSYS Maxwell 2D/3D, Motor-CAD, JMAG.
- An understanding of the requirements of automotive technology and knowledge of the relevant standards are an advantage.
- Interest in electrical machines and drive technology, as well as enthusiasm for eMobility.
- Results oriented and independent way of thinking.
